Kimberly-Clark Professional has recently launched the Kleenex Ultra embossed rolled paper hand towel and a new compact dispenser.

The company claims a branded product is preferred by twice as many users than an unbranded product.

The firm also says that strength and absorbency means fewer towels are used.

“Facility Managers have to provide the best washroom experience possible to maintain user satisfaction and keep complaints to a minimum, but under the pressure of delivering operational efficiencies and keeping within their existing budget,” says James Hallam, the brand manager for the new product. “This new towel is designed to provide comfort and care without compromising on efficiency.” 

The product works together with the compact Aquarius dispenser which carries two rolls.  The stub roll is used to the full with normal single-sheet dispensing until the roll is finished before switching to roll 2.
